Fort Lyon
Fort Lyon is an unincorporated community and U.S. Post Office in Bent County, Colorado, United States.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Fort Lyon National Cemetery
Cemetery
Photo: Denverjeffrey, CC BY 3.0.
Fort Lyon National Cemetery is a United States National Cemetery located near the city of Las Animas in Bent County, Colorado. It encompasses 51.9 acres and as of 2014 had 2,556 interments.
Fort Lyon
Social service facility
Photo: Denverjeffrey, CC BY 3.0.
Fort Lyon was composed of two 19th-century military fort complexes in southeastern Colorado. The initial fort, also called Fort Wise, operated from 1860 to 1867.

Boggsville
Locality
Photo: ERoss99,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Boggsville is an extinct town located in Bent County, Colorado, United States. The town was located near the Purgatoire River about 3 miles above the Purgatoire's confluence with the Arkansas River. Boggsville is situated 5 miles southwest of Fort Lyon.
